Output 76542256ef0e646425ab8f81e3b7d2981242d1970727e21fcfcf0af92f92a05e:0

value
20287000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d732549e9b34bbea7bc2491a7d4368076237cb7 OP_EQUALVERIFY OP_CHECKSIG
address
184WyES5Ppg8DFayKjScCC79By4a685wKc
transaction
76542256ef0e646425ab8f81e3b7d2981242d1970727e21fcfcf0af92f92a05e
spent
true